    Pakistan has a total of 69 airports, including three major hubs in Karachi, Islamabad, and Lahore.Six additional medium-sized airports are located in Peshawar, Multan, Sialkot, Faisalabad, Quetta, and Sukkur, while the remaining are classified as smaller airports.

    Karachi Area Control Centre (Urdu: کراچی ہوائی مرکز اختیار) is one of two Area Control Centers in Pakistan operated by the Pakistan Civil Aviation Authority and is based in Terminal 1 at Jinnah International Airport in Karachi. [1]

    PCAA's head office is situated in Terminal-1 of Jinnah International Airport in Karachi. [3] PCAA is a member state of the International Civil Aviation Organization . [ 4 ] Nearly all 44 civilian airports in Pakistan are owned and operated by the PCAA.
